git怎么加入别人的储存库
-
加入别人的储存库有两种常见的方法:一种是Fork别人的储存库,另一种是克隆别人的储存库。
方法一:Fork别人的储存库
1. 打开目标储存库的页面,点击页面右上角的“Fork”按钮。
2. 在弹出的对话框中选择要将储存库Fork到的目标地址,例如你自己的GitHub账号或者组织。
3. 等待储存库Fork完成,你将得到一个与原始储存库完全相同的储存库副本。方法二:克隆别人的储存库
1. 打开目标储存库的页面,复制储存库的URL地址。
2. 打开Git Bash或者其他命令行工具,在你想要保存储存库的目录中执行以下命令:
“`
git clone 储存库的URL地址
“`
这将会在本地创建一个与目标储存库完全一样的副本。无论你选择哪种方法,你都可以在克隆或Fork后对储存库进行本地修改和提交。如果你想将自己的修改合并到目标储存库中,可以提交一个“Pull Request”(PR)。目标储存库的所有者将会审核你的修改,并决定是否接受你的PR。
通过以上方法,你就可以轻松地加入别人的储存库并参与到项目的开发中了。
2年前 -
要加入别人的储存库,可以按照以下步骤进行操作:
1. 克隆远程储存库:
使用 `git clone` 命令将远程储存库克隆到本地。首先,获取远程储存库的地址,例如:`https://github.com/username/repository.git`。然后,在终端中运行以下命令:
“`
git clone https://github.com/username/repository.git
“`
这将在当前目录下创建一个名为 `repository` 的文件夹,并将远程储存库中的所有文件下载到该文件夹中。2. 进入储存库目录:
使用 `cd` 命令进入储存库的目录:
“`
cd repository
“`3. 查看远程储存库信息:
运行以下命令查看远程储存库的信息,包括远程分支和远程地址:
“`
git remote -v
“`4. 添加远程储存库:
如果 `git remote -v` 命令没有显示任何远程储存库,那么需要将远程储存库添加到本地。运行以下命令添加远程储存库,并为其命名。例如,给远程储存库起名为 `origin`:
“`
git remote add origin https://github.com/username/repository.git
“`
这将将远程储存库的地址添加为 `origin`。5. 拉取远程分支:
使用 `git pull` 命令拉取远程分支的最新更改:
“`
git pull origin branch-name
“`
其中,`branch-name` 是远程分支的名称。现在,你已经成功加入了别人的远程储存库,并下载了所有文件。你可以在本地进行修改和提交,并在合适的时候将更改推送到远程储存库。
2年前 -
在Git中加入别人的储存库,通常可以通过以下几个步骤完成:
1. 克隆远程储存库:首先需要将远程储存库克隆到本地,可以使用`git clone`命令。例如,假设远程储存库的URL是`https://github.com/user/repo.git`,可以运行以下命令:
“`
git clone https://github.com/user/repo.git
“`
这将在当前目录下创建一个名为`repo`的文件夹,并将远程储存库的文件复制到该文件夹中。2. 进入储存库文件夹:克隆完成后,需要进入刚刚创建的储存库文件夹。
“`
cd repo
“`3. 查看远程储存库信息:可以使用`git remote`命令查看远程储存库的信息。
“`
git remote -v
“`
这将显示远程储存库的名称和URL。4. 添加远程储存库:如果上一步没有显示别人的储存库信息,需要手动添加远程储存库。
“`
git remote add origin https://github.com/user/repo.git
“`
其中`origin`是远程储存库的名称,可以自定义。5. 更新远程储存库:运行以下命令可以将远程储存库的变化更新到本地。
“`
git fetch origin
“`6. 合并远程分支:通过运行`git merge`命令将远程分支合并到本地分支。
“`
git merge origin/master
“`
这将将远程分支`origin/master`合并到当前分支。7. 推送本地分支:如果想要将本地分支的更改推送到远程储存库,可以使用`git push`命令。
“`
git push origin master
“`
这将推送本地分支`master`的更改到远程储存库。以上就是将自己加入别人的储存库的步骤。需要注意的是,如果别人的储存库有写权限限制,可能需要获得相关权限才能推送更改。
2年前